Description

'John Taylor Chemicals Mcp Amine 4e' is an herbicide terrestrial. Its Federal EPA registration number is: 7729-6067. It was originally approved by EPA on 01 Jan 1976. Its registration got cancelled on 29 Sep 1988. It has a 'Warning' signal word. It has the following active ingredients: MCPA, dimethylamine salt. It's approved for 13 sites including barley, buildings, ditches, fencerows, noncrop areas, nonfood crop areas, oats, ornamental turf, rice, and roadsides. It is also approved for 14 pests and pest groups including but not limited to annual mustards, arrowhead, broadleaf weeds, bulrush, dandelion, lambsquarters, no pest, nutgrass, plantain, and redstem.
